Unlocking Excellence: Understanding Quality BLDC Hood Motors for Kitchen Appliances

Brushless DC (BLDC) motors have emerged as a pivotal component in modern kitchen appliances, particularly in range hoods. Their design and functionality contribute significantly to the performance and efficiency of these essential kitchen devices. When discussing “quality BLDC hood motors,” it’s crucial to understand the technological advancements and benefits they bring to the kitchen appliance market.
One of the primary advantages of quality BLDC hood motors is their high efficiency. Unlike traditional brushed motors, BLDC motors operate without brushes, which reduces friction and wear. This design leads to higher efficiency, often exceeding 90%, allowing for better energy consumption in kitchen ventilation. Consequently, a quality BLDC hood motor can significantly lower operational costs over time, making it an attractive choice for manufacturers and consumers alike.
Another critical feature of quality BLDC hood motors is their quiet operation. The absence of brushes not only enhances efficiency but also minimizes noise levels, creating a more pleasant cooking environment. For those who frequently use their kitchen, a quieter range hood is an invaluable asset. The smooth operation of BLDC motors ensures that kitchen ventilation is effective without being disruptive.
Additionally, the durability of BLDC motors is noteworthy. Quality BLDC hood motors are designed to withstand the rigors of a busy kitchen, where exposure to heat and grease can be a common concern. Their robust construction translates into a longer lifespan compared to traditional motors, which means less frequent replacements and maintenance. This reliability is crucial for both manufacturers looking to reduce warranty claims and consumers desiring a dependable kitchen appliance.
Moreover, quality BLDC hood motors often come equipped with advanced control systems that allow for variable speed settings. This feature enables users to adjust the airflow according to their specific cooking needs, whether they are simmering a sauce or frying food. The adaptability of these motors enhances not only user experience but also the overall air quality in the kitchen.
In conclusion, when considering a quality BLDC hood motor for kitchen appliances, it’s vital to recognize the benefits of efficiency, noise reduction, durability, and advanced control features. As the demand for high-performance kitchen equipment continues to rise, investing in quality BLDC technology will undoubtedly elevate the functionality and satisfaction of kitchen ventilation systems. By focusing on these key aspects, manufacturers can ensure that they are meeting consumer needs while advancing their product offerings in the competitive landscape of kitchen appliances.
